Compare all specifications:

2003 Alfa Romeo 166 1972 Datsun 240Z
Make Alfa Romeo Datsun
Model 166 240Z
Year Released 2003 1972
Body Type Sedan Hatchback
Engine Position Front Front
Engine Size 2959 cc 2393 cc
Engine Cylinders 6 cylinders 6 cylinders
Engine Type V in-line
Horse Power 217 HP 151 HP
Engine RPM 6300 RPM 5600 RPM
Torque 265 Nm 198 Nm
Torque RPM 5000 RPM 4400 RPM
Engine Bore Size 93 mm 83 mm
Engine Stroke Size 72.6 mm 73.7 mm
Engine Compression Ratio 10.0:1 9.0:1
Top Speed 236 km/hour 201 km/hour
Acceleration 0-100mph 8.6 seconds 8 seconds
Drive Type Front Rear
Transmission Type Automatic Manual
Number of Seats 5 seats 2 seats
Number of Doors 4 doors 3 doors
Vehicle Weight 1550 kg 1068 kg
Vehicle Length 4730 mm 4140 mm
Vehicle Width 1810 mm 1630 mm
Wheelbase Size 2600 mm 2300 mm
Fuel Consumption Overall 13 L/100km 11 L/100km
